Faculty-Carol Vogel

Carol Vogel is known for her realistic and expressive paintings.
Paintings that dance with energy, color, and form that are influenced by the classical style of the old masters best describe my painting style.  A love of collecting vintage glass and ceramics inspire my still life paintings along with a passion for travel to international locations.  My still life paintings reflect a mood and feeling often with lush pattern backgrounds, vivid color, and unusual combinations of supports and collectible items.

I live on an ambient and peaceful pond that serves as a meeting ground for a wide variety of birds.  Many variety of ducks, blue and white heron, osprey, eagles, swans, and migrating bird species grace the waters during the year.  I find inspiration for large bird paintings in both oil and pastel from their presence.   

I started planning and escorting international painting tours in 1998.  Originally partnering with The Art League School of Alexandria, Va. and then branching out on my own, I have escorted and taught painting groups in Ireland, Italy, and France, and Corsica.  In addition I hold weekly art classes and workshops in my home, teaching studio as well as Kensington, MD.  

For 10 years I co-owned an event and travel business.  Each year I marketed and escorted tours and cruises to locations in Europe, Canada, Alaska, New Zealand, Australia, Africa, and Asia.  My extensive travel inspires my paintings.

I began teaching drawing and painting in 2008.  Right from the start I realized how much I enjoy sharing my art knowledge and skill with both young and adult students.  Seeing them grow and flourish in their artistic vision and accomplishment is a special joy of mine. 

I work from my home studio located in Annapolis, Maryland.
